Snack Recipe: Chicken Sandwich

Nothing beats a chicken sandwich for breakfast or an afternoon snack, and kids love it too. Here is a quick recipe you can make in about 10 minutes.

Ingredients

  • Boneless chicken (200 g)
  • Ginger-garlic paste (1 teaspoon)
  • Hard-boiled egg (1)
  • Carrot (1)
  • Cucumber (1 small)
  • Mayonnaise (2 tablespoons)
  • Salt (to taste)
  • Black pepper powder (1 teaspoon)
  • White sandwich bread

Method

  1. Finely grate the carrot and cucumber and squeeze out excess water. Boil the chicken with ginger-garlic paste until cooked through, about 5–7 minutes. Shred the chicken into very small pieces. Add the grated carrot and cucumber, mayonnaise, and salt. Grate in the hard-boiled egg and mix well. Season with black pepper to taste. This mixture is the sandwich filling. You can refrigerate it for up to a week.
  2. Trim the crusts from square slices of white bread with a knife. Do not throw the crusts away — toast and grind them into breadcrumbs for later use. Spread the filling on one slice, top with another, and cut into sandwich triangles. Serve.
